Position SummaryAn Aerial Lineman must have knowledge of established aerial cable installation procedures and techniques. This position will construct strand infrastructure and secure fiber optic cable. This is a safety sensitive position.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ities- Safely drive, operate, and maintain bucket truck.
- Maintain tool, material, and required safety gear inventory.
- Plan and initiate projects.
- Maintain thorough compliance with all federal, state, and local safety requirements.
- Maintain and repair overhead fiber optic facilities.
- Install new hardware, strand, fiber optic cable, and Multi Service Terminals on existing utility poles.
- Install and maintain anchors, down guys, overhead guys, etc.
- Provide technical skills necessary for precise and timely operation and maintenance of FTTP deployments with an emphasis on quality.
- Keep abreast of all changes affecting any records, reports, and related information affecting this position.
- Set a good example by always following and teaching safe practices.
- Present a positive and professional image for CEC, serving as the initial public face of the company.
- Must be a team player and problem solver who can facilitate teamwork between different aspects of construction, while maintaining high morale and meeting production goals.
- Constructing strand infrastructure and securing fiber optic cable.
- Performs other related duties as assigned to ensure efficient and effective processes, completion of projects and smooth operation of department.
Education and Experience
- High School Diploma or GED required.
- At least one year of experience.
- Proficient with all phases of line construction.
- Compliant with proper safety standards, procedures, and work practices.
- A valid Drivers License.
- OSHA 10
- CDL Class A drivers license is desired but not required
Required Skills, Knowledge, and Abilities
- Understanding of basic and/or advanced Fiber Installation principles
- Assumes full responsibility for completed work, perform routine line work without close supervision, completing work with quality and timeliness
- Ability to read and interpret construction prints, plans and specifications
- Ability to operate efficiently a bucket truck, and other equipment required to complete routine aerial construction
- Must have adequate time management skills
- Pass DOT medical physical
- Will be operating DOT registered vehicles.
- Must be in compliance with DOT regulations.
